Screening applicants is a part of the overall hiring process and often takes place before the actual on-site interview. A well-developed screening process makes it possible to quickly and efficiently create a shortlist of qualified individuals.

WebMay 4, 2024 · The Friedman Test is a non-parametric alternative to the Repeated Measures ANOVA. It is used to determine whether or not there is a statistically significant difference between the means of three or more groups in which the same subjects show up in each group.
